Casinos.com was backstage at the NEXT.io event to catch up with some of the keynote speakers. It was a fast and furious experience, as most industry leaders were jetting off to another destination — par for the course in their busy lives.

We’re glad to say that Nadiya Attard, CCO of Elantil, was able to spare some time in her very busy schedule to give us an exclusive interview. We spoke to her outside the Mediterranean Conference Centre in Valletta, Malta.

Nadiya has more than 20 years of iGaming experience and knows the industry inside out.

Before joining Elantil, she held senior positions at Relax Gaming, NetEnt, Games Global, and Betfair, expanding their market presence and forging invaluable partnerships to drive growth.

Known for her ability to navigate highly regulated markets, including the U.S., she’s practically a GPS for your iGaming journey, wherever it leads. 

Nicknamed “Turbo Mode” for her unmatched efficiency and energy, Nadiya boasts an impressive track record of exceeding targets. At Elantil, she’s driving innovation and collaboration, providing operators with a rock-solid roadmap to success.

Forging a Path Through Global Regulation

Alan: "Nadiya, the panel discussion you took part in was quite intense, mainly focused on regulations and the way companies are having to navigate different geo-regulations and work with various governments. How much of a struggle is that for a company like yours trying to forge ahead in new markets globally?"

Nadiya: "I think from our side, we are very fortunate because we have a lot of experience. Each of us has a minimum of 20 years in this industry — just within the C-suite group, we have around 250 years of combined experience.

"We’ve been through every regulation, starting from Italy and the UK, through to the U.S. and beyond. So, we know what to do, and even the way we build the product caters to regulations. For us, it's easy. But looking at other B2B or B2C businesses, it’s quite complex.

"It’s challenging in terms of product adaptation, differing requirements, and time.For instance, it takes about 18 months to get a licence to operate in the U.S. due to due diligence and other requirements, not the product. That takes time and effort."

Alan: "How much time do you give to that? Is it draining your time from other priorities?"

Nadiya: "Definitely — it depends.

"At the moment we’re doing GLI certification and we’re doing ISO certification, both of which are needed. We’re also building a product that complies with those certifications.

"But let’s say Germany or the UK introduce a new change — then yes, it’s draining our time. As fast as you comply, others pop up who don’t and go to places where it’s easy pickings — no regulations, no policies, no safeguarding."

Alan: "Why such strong and stringent rules on the regulated when perhaps more effort should go into shutting down the unregulated?"

Nadiya: "Both, actually — it's not so simple to close the unregulated. But also, it has to be simple and, most importantly, knowledgeable.

"People drafting the regulations — as Dino mentioned on the panel — often don’t have a clue what they’re writing. They come up with things without understanding them, and everyone has to comply with something that doesn’t make sense. I think education and listening to what makes sense — those will make everyone’s life easier."

Balancing Career, Family and Leadership

Alan: "Just tell me a bit about you now."

Nadiya: "I love my job; I enjoy it. I give a lot back to work, and this industry is enjoyable. There are so many intriguing people. You learn a lot — so I think it balances out."

Alan: "So just give me a quick tour — the journey of Nadiya Attard to CCO. Where did it all begin?"

Nadiya: "From the very, very bottom. I literally worked my way up from the very beginning. Back in the day, it was all so simple."

Alan: "How simple?"

Nadiya: "I started as an outbound agent. Actually, I began in land-based gaming and then moved to Malta, where I worked for Betfair. 

"Back then, one day you’re working in customer support; the next day you’re marketing manager, simply because you happen to speak the language. Then you’re country manager, again for the same reason.

"I learned a lot and I was never scared to try new things. I enjoy it, and I’m happy to share my experience. 

"I got a question the other day: “What can I do? It’s so difficult to enter gaming.” It’s not. Just try, try hard, and don’t give up."

Alan: "What country are you originally from?"

Nadiya: "I’m actually Maltese, but I was born in Ukraine. Most of my life I’ve lived here, but my family is still in Ukraine."

Alan: "What advice would you give to a young Nadiya, just starting out — going into work, university, or academia? Would you recommend this industry?"

Nadiya: "I wasn’t planning to enter this industry, actually. When I came to Malta, companies were searching for people with gaming knowledge — they literally dragged me into it.

"But I don’t regret it — I enjoy it so much. It’s so interesting, you build something new. I’m on the B2B side, which means I help people do things. And I work with tech.

"I studied tech, I understand tech, and that’s what makes it more enjoyable. When you understand tech and commercial, and you can align both — not just two parties win, but three. It’s a rare skill — understanding everyone and finding solutions. It’s not easy, but that’s what I enjoy."
